Ticket: Staging env misconfigured for Siftgate bloom filter

The bloom layer in front of the Pellet KV store is rejecting all lookups in staging because the env file was copied from the dev template without credentials. False-positive tuning values are fine; only the auth line is missing. To unblock the weekly demo, the Pellet admission secret must be set on the following line.

env line for yaguf-fajop: LEDGER_TOKEN13=fb08984397349

Heads up before you start poking at the Nimbuswell session endpoints: there's a known bug where refreshed tokens occasionally come back with the old expiry timestamp. The Ledgerfox team has a fix queued for the next sprint, but until then, just force a full re-auth if you see a stale expiry. To test against the staging gateway, you'll need the internal service key, which you can find right here below.

API key for yahig-tadup: kto7_ubizbYm

## Service accounts for Squintjar SQL linting

If your plugin submits SQL files to the Squintjar lint service, don't use your personal token — grab a service account instead. It keeps rate limits sane and means your plugin won't break when you change teams. Service accounts are scoped to lint-only: they can read rule configs and post results, nothing else. For wiring up your plugin against the lint endpoint, use the key below.

API key for tagug-tajef: vxb4-R1fo

14:22 — Firmware update channel for the Vexling H4 doorbell stalled mid-rollout; roughly 8% of devices fetched a truncated manifest. Staged delivery was paused by the Orvane scheduler and the manifest regenerated from the signing node. Devices recovered on next poll. The build that produced the bad manifest is noted below for reference.

session token of tajef-bageg = htk21_5d90d574934f3ccae6437

## Regenerating the Lintweave baseline

Plugin authors must regenerate `baseline.lintweave.json` whenever a new rule category is introduced, otherwise existing violations will surface as hard failures for downstream consumers. Run the regeneration task in a clean checkout, commit the file unchanged by formatters, and note the toolchain revision in your PR description. The baseline was last regenerated against the following build.

trace token, tawep-fahif: htk3_b58